For example, Nálepka's group would give the local population information about the situation on the front lines, sabotage railway tracks, and give false information to German military aviators, so that they would bomb uninhabited forest areas instead of towns and villages. On the night between 14 and 15 June 1943, Nálepka and several other Slovak officers and soldiers defected from the Slovak Army and joined the partisans. They formed a partisan detachment and fought against the German troops, and called for Slovak soldiers to join them. Nálepka was made commander of
